FESTIVAL INTERNACIONAL CERVANTINO

October 14 - November 1, 2009

This year’s international music festival features more than 2,300 artists and 25 nations from 5 continents in venues throughout the colonial city of Guanajuato with guests of honor Quebec and the state of Zacatecas. The theme for the year is Galileo and the Telescope: 400 years in honor of the International Year of Astronomy. In this guide, you will find event recommendations, venue information including hotels, restaurants and activities along with ticket information.

During the weekend, Guanajuato's center can be very crowded, so we have selected events that take place during the week or in venues outside of Centro on the weekends. Many events sell out, so purchase your tickets early and make your reservations in hotels and restaurants as soon as possible. Have fun and enjoy the Festival!

RECOMMENDED EVENTS

Wednesday, October 14 **Sold Out**
Montreal Symphony Orchestra
Teatro Juárez, 9:00pm
Tickets: $190.00 - $510.00 MX

montreal symphony orchestra

The Montreal Symphony Orchestra performs, under the baton of Jean-François Rivest, a program that goes from romantic to modern following the theme of this year's Festival.

The program features one of the greatest pianists of our time, Marc-Andre Hamelin and the female choral section of the Mexico Symphony Orchestra.

Thursday, October 15
Zacatecas Philharmonic Orchestra
Templo de la Compañía, 5:00pm
Tickets: $280.00 MX

zacatecas orchestra

Jose Luis Castillo directs the Zacatecas Philharmonic in a program dedicated to Galileo Galilei.

On the program this evening music by Félix Mendelssohn, Manuel M. Ponce and Paul Hindemith.

Thursday, October 15
Parabelo/ Onqotó, Grupo Corpo Auditorio del Estado, 8:00pm
Tickets: $110.00 - $240.00 MX

grupo corpo
Grupo Corpo is a dazzling example of the expressive power of the dance of Brazil.

Wednesday, October 21
Galileo Project. The Music of the Spheres
Tafelmusik Baroque Orchestra
Mario Ivan Martinez
Teatro Juárez, 9:00pm
Tickets: $190.00 - $510.00 MX

Tafelmusik Baroque Orchestra

The program by the Canadian group Tafelmusik and Mexican actor Mario Ivan Martinez traces a route aesthetic, geographical, scientific and philosophical, with different languages and styles -- Bach, Vivaldi, Monteverdi, Lully, Purcell, Handel, Rameau, Zelenka plus the work of brother Michelangelo Galilei.

The Galileo Project premiered in the Banff Center for the Arts under the direction of violinist Jeanne Lamon.

Friday, October 23
Medieval Music and the Time of Galileo
Los Tiempos Pasados
Templo de la Valenciana, 12:00
Tickets: $260.00 MX

TBaroque

The group, guided by Armando López Valdivia presents a charming blend of medieval and Renaissance music.

The program includes pieces by Vincenzo Galilei, in celebration of his illustrious son, the astronomer Galileo.

Friday, Saturday and Sunday, October 23-25
Nebbia, Cirque Éloize
Auditorio del Estado, 8:00pm
Tickets: $60.00 MX

Cirque Eloze

Nebbia is a creation of Cirque Éloize in co-production with Teatro Sunil. Meaning fog in Italian, Nebbia explores the world of dreams and the imaginary. Friday, October 30
ECM+(Ensemble Contemporain de Montreal+) and Ónix Ensamble
Templo de la Valenciana, 12:00
Tickets: $260.00 MX

monarch butterfly

ECM from Montreal and Ónix Ensamble from Mexico team to produce a multimedia concert dedicated to the indelible beauty of the Monarch butterfly.

Saturday, October 31
Mischa Malsky
Templo de la Valenciana, 12:00
Tickets: $260.00 MX

Mischa

Cellist Mischa Maisky explores the series of six suites for solo cello by Johann Sebastian Bach against the backdrop of the beauty of the Templo de la Valenciana.
